最近配合本部门的一位工程师做投诉的数据割接,主要就是将旧系统中的数据导入到新系统中,这里用了一个工具sqlldr。这是一个比较好的快捷的工具,很适合批量导入数据。
本人也参考了网络上的一些文章,现将总结的用法归结如下:
一、导入命令:
1、进入伪dos,然后再进入导入文件根目录如:
原创
2008-10-20 19:18:02
6932阅读
点赞
3评论
背景900W数据的TXT文本,文件内容各字段以"|"分隔,使用nevicat导入太慢解决办法使用sqlldr导入数据,1)建立配置文件test.ctl[oracle@slave1 ~]$ cat test.ctlload datainfile 'data.txt' into table CMCCfields terminated by "|"(id,phone,service_id,time,cm
原创
2016-09-07 16:27:34
1180阅读
在现代应用中,数据的导入与管理是一个关键任务。特别是在使用Oracle数据库时,我们通常会遇到使用`sqlldr`(SQL*Loader)导入数据到数据库中的需求。今天,我将分享一个关于如何通过Java实现使用`sqlldr`导入数据库的深入探讨,包括背景定位、演进历程、架构设计、性能攻坚、复盘总结和扩展应用。
## 背景定位
### 业务场景分析
在我们的项目中,拥有大量的数据需要定期上传
建表: create table system.COMMUNITY_PRICE(
"CITY_CODE" NUMBER(6,0) NOT NULL ENABLE,
"COURT_ID" NUMBER(6,0) NOT NULL ENABLE,
"COURT_NAME" VARCHAR2(200),
"COURT_ADDR" VARCHAR2(255),
"HOUSE_T
原创
2021-04-21 20:59:40
775阅读
需求:数据迁移,将txt文件中的内容导入oracle数据库的表中,文本文件中数据格式如下(数据以空格隔开) 1. 创建与文本数据格式相匹配的表(此处在scott用户下创建) 2. 创建后缀名为 .ctl 的文件,用来加载数据到数据库中 load.ctl 内容解释见链接 3. 将数据文件 data.t
转载
2017-10-30 23:00:00
213阅读
Oracle数据导入导出imp/exp 功能:Oracle数据导入导出imp/exp就相当与oracle数据还原与备份。 大多情况都可以用Oracle数据导入导出完成数据的备份和还原(不会造成数据的丢失)。 Oracle有个好处,虽然你的电脑不是服务器,但是你装了oracle客户端,并建立了连接 (通过Net Configuration Assistant添加正确的服务命名,其实你可以想成
原创
2013-04-25 09:41:42
3220阅读
前言最近有一个将 excel 中的数据批量导入到 oracl 数据库中的需求,首先想到
原创
2022-12-21 10:43:54
672阅读
前段时间了解到了sqlldr这个功能,感觉很不错就尝试着搞一下。我也是通过查阅网上的资料了解并实验的,如果有什么说的不对或者有需要补充的希望大牛们多多指点。
转载
2023-06-02 06:23:38
229阅读
由于项目需要,需要向数据库中导入6000万条数据。现有的资源是txt文本(数据用“,”分开的)。 方案一:转换成insert语
原创
2023-10-09 10:10:56
612阅读
若想要在plsql环境下执行exp,imp语句,则需要在前面加host或者$
原创
2021-07-22 21:18:32
10000+阅读
你用命令 exp name/password@dbname file=d:/filename.dmp这样导出的是整个数据库,包括了表、视图、触发器等所有内容。
原创
2021-07-09 11:51:05
2642阅读
如果已有先删除sqlplus sys/orcl as sysdbadrop user oawf1;drop tablespace oawf1;然后手动删除表空间文件。//Oracle 创建表空间 创建用户 授予表空间 授予dba权限 导入dmp数据文件 //命令行以dba身份登录sqlplus sys/orcl as sysdba//创建表空间create tablespace oawf
转载
精选
2015-05-14 23:32:46
671阅读
connect username/password@hostname:port/SERVICENAME select sys_context('USERENV','SERVICE_NAME') from dual
转载
2017-09-11 18:21:00
217阅读
2评论
Oracle数据导入导出imp/exp就相当于oracle数据还原与备份。exp命令可以把数据从远程数据库服务器导出到本地的dmp文件, imp命令可以把dmp文件从本地导入到远处的数据库服务器中。 利用这个功能可以构建两个相同的数据库,一个用来测试,一个用来正式使用。 下面介绍的是导入导出的实例。(注意:不用连接到SQL/plus,直接在DOS下
原创
2011-02-28 12:41:01
583阅读
点赞
以下命令也可直接在dos环境下直接运行(不用加$):expsystem/system@xcfile=c:/hehe.dmpfull=y*备注:在SQLPlus(不是SQLPlusWorksheet)环境下导入导出必须在前面加上$表示主机运行Oracle数据库导入导出命令(备份与恢复)Toad一个很好的oralce数据库操作与管理工具,使用它可以很方便地导入导出数据表,用户以及整个数据库。今天在这里
转载
精选
2013-09-27 12:27:51
2140阅读
点赞
数据导出①将数据库orcl完全导出exp lims/limsadmin@orcl file=d:lims_20150104.dmp full=y②将数据库中lims用户导出exp lims/limsadmin@testl001 file=d:daochu.dmp owner=(lims)③将数据库中的表导出exp lims/limsadmin@testl001 file=d:daochu.dmp
原创
2015-01-04 11:15:04
579阅读
Oracle数据导入导出imp/exp就相当于oracle数据还原与备份。exp命令可以把数据从远程数据库服务器导出到本地的dmp文件,imp命令可以把dmp文件从本地导入到远处的数据库服务器中。 利用这个功能可以构建两个相同的数据库,一个用来测试,一个用来正式使用。 执行环境:可以在SQLPLUS.EXE或者DOS(命令行)中执行, DOS中可以执行时由于 在oracle 8
原创
2015-03-27 14:48:32
652阅读
1、导入导出步骤:1.创建目录(用于存放导出数据)mkdir 目录名2.给目录授权:chown -R oracle testorclchown -R anychat:anychat *3.su - oracle到oracle 用户下->sqlplus4.create directory +虚拟目录 as '实际存放数据目录'5,grant read,write on directory 虚拟
原创
2017-03-01 10:00:48
1107阅读
点赞
oracle导出dmp文件: 开始->运行->输入cmd->输入 exp user/password@IP地址:1521/数据库实例 file=文件所在目录 (如:exp user/password@192.168.141.40:1521/orcl file=E:\work\dmp\person.d
转载
2017-01-12 17:47:00
172阅读
2评论
***********用工具导入(导出)数据工具(T)—》导出表(X)工具(T)—》导出表(X)
所选运行文件位置:
E:\oracle\product\10.2.0\db_1\bin\imp.exe(exp.exe)*********命令导入导出
oracle导入dmp文件命令:
(1)dmp文件里的数据导入数据库
1.首先进入cmd命令窗体
2.运行命令:imp userid=userna
转载
2017-05-07 11:13:00
161阅读
2评论